sql >> Database teknologi >  >> RDS >> PostgreSQL

Postgres:Valg af Distinct på en kolonne returnerer ikke distinkte resultater med Joins

Fjern "broadcasts"."created_at" fra DISTINCT prædikat, fordi det returnerer ikke-unikke værdier, derfor dublerede songs . Hvis du skal bruge disse oplysninger til at sortere, skal du oprette et nyt spørgsmål.




  1. INDRE JOIN Hvor Klausul

  2. Valg af unikke rækker i et sæt af to muligheder

  3. PostgreSQL-streaming vs logisk replikering – sammenligning

  4. vælg distinct count(id) vs select count(distinct id)